Product Information

Phosphomolybdic acid hydrate is a versatile and valuable compound widely utilized in analytical chemistry and various industrial applications. This hydrated form of phosphomolybdic acid serves as an essential reagent in the qualitative and quantitative analysis of organic compounds, particularly in the detection of alkaloids and other nitrogen-containing substances. Its unique properties allow it to form stable complexes with a variety of metals, making it an effective catalyst in organic synthesis and a key component in the preparation of molybdenum-based catalysts.

Researchers and industry professionals appreciate phosphomolybdic acid hydrate for its ability to enhance the sensitivity and selectivity of analytical methods, such as UV-Vis spectroscopy and chromatography. Its role as a staining agent in microscopy further underscores its importance in biological and material sciences. With its broad range of applications, phosphomolybdic acid hydrate stands out as a crucial tool for enhancing research outcomes and improving process efficiencies in various fields.

CAS Number
51429-74-4
Grade
ACS reagent
Molecular Formula
H3[P(Mo3O10)4] · xH2O
Molecular Weight
1825.25
MDL Number
MFCD00011341
PubChem ID
16211564
Melting Point
79 - 90 ºC (Lit.)
Appearance
Yellow crystalline powder
Conditions
Store at RT

Applications

Phosphomolybdic acid hydrate is widely utilized in research focused on:

  • Catalysis: It serves as a catalyst in organic reactions, particularly in the oxidation of alcohols, enhancing reaction rates and yields.
  • Analytical Chemistry: This compound is used in colorimetric assays to detect and quantify various substances, such as phosphates and proteins, providing accurate results in laboratory settings.
  • Material Science: It plays a role in the synthesis of advanced materials, including nanostructures, which are essential in electronics and photonics.
  • Biochemistry: Researchers utilize it for enzyme assays, helping to study enzyme kinetics and mechanisms, which is crucial for drug development.
  • Environmental Science: Phosphomolybdic acid hydrate is employed in the analysis of environmental samples, aiding in the detection of heavy metals and pollutants in water and soil.
